About the Role
K&B Transportation is hiring full-time CDL A Truck Drivers based out of Walterboro, Colleton County, with company driving positions available nationwide. This is a straightforward over-the-road opportunity built for professional drivers who want dependable weekly earnings and meaningful time at home — without the runaround. You haul no-touch freight, run hard, and get rewarded for it.
Key Responsibilities
- Operate a company tractor-trailer safely and on schedule across nationwide lanes
- Transport 100% no-touch freight from pickup to delivery
- Maintain compliance with DOT regulations, hours-of-service rules, and company safety standards
- Complete required pre-trip and post-trip inspections and accurate trip documentation
- Communicate consistently with dispatch to keep loads moving on time
Qualifications
- Valid Class A Commercial Driver's License (CDL A)
- Clean and verifiable driving record
- Willingness to run over-the-road on nationwide routes
- Commitment to safe, professional, and reliable driving
Compensation
Earn up to $2,200 per week as a company driver, with a guaranteed minimum of $1,725 per week*, starting pay of 75 cents per mile (CPM), and the potential to reach $100,000 per year*. (*As stated by the employer.)

The role is based in Walterboro, Colleton County, South Carolina—a Southeastern state on the Atlantic coast, bordered by North Carolina and Georgia.
South Carolina is a state in the Southeastern, South Atlantic and Deep South regions of the United States. It borders North Carolina to the north and northeast, the Atlantic Ocean to the southeast, and Georgia to the west and south across the Savannah River. Typical work in CDL A Truck Driver - Up to $2,200 per week
Independent occupational context from O*NET (U.S. public-domain labor data). This is about the occupation, not a rewrite of this employer's posting.
- Check all load-related documentation for completeness and accuracy.
- Inspect loads to ensure that cargo is secure.
- Check vehicles to ensure that mechanical, safety, and emergency equipment is in good working order.
- Crank trailer landing gear up or down to safely secure vehicles.
- Obtain receipts or signatures for delivered goods and collect payment for services when required.
- Maintain logs of working hours or of vehicle service or repair status, following applicable state and federal regulations.
